Leverage Shares 3x Long Semiconductors ETP Securities Profile

XAMS Exchange
Germany Country
Leverage Shares 3x Long Semiconductors ETP Securities is an exchange-traded product (ETP) designed to provide three times the daily return of the VanEck Vectors Semiconductor ETF, adjusted for fees and costs associated with maintaining the leveraged position. It achieves this through physical replication by directly investing in shares of the underlying ETF and using margin borrowing to acquire additional shares, amplifying both potential gains and losses on a daily basis. For instance, a 1% daily increase in the ETF would target a 3% rise in the ETP, excluding fees, while a 1% decline would result in a 3% drop. Key features include an intraday rebalance mechanism known as the 'airbag' to mitigate significant intra-day falls, liquidity supported by multiple market makers, and a structure that limits losses to the invested amount with minimized credit risk due to full ownership of underlying assets. Issued by Leverage Shares PLC, this debt security caters to sophisticated traders monitoring positions intraday, offering simple access to leveraged semiconductor sector exposure without needing futures or personal margin accounts. Available in select European countries, it operates in USD with an annual management fee applied.
